100 Haryani Villages Connected With Wi Fi: B’Day Gift To Atal

[New Delhi,CHD] 100 Haryani Villages Connected With Wi Fi
Haryana government today connected 100 villages with Wi-Fi services and decided to rename all common service centres (CSCs) opened in urban and rural areas as well as E-disha centres as “Atal Seva Kendras” at district headquarters.
This was announced by Chief Minister Manohar Lal Khattar while launching 53 new IT services pertaining to six departments on “Good Governance Day”.
He also conducted a draw of the digital transaction award scheme meant to promote cashless transactions in the state.
65 winners were awarded five prizes of Rs 10,000 each,
10 prizes of Rs 5,000 each and
50 prizes of Rs 1,000 each for proactively transacting cashless.
With the introduction of new IT facilities, citizens would get 170 e-services through “Atal Seva Kendras” in the state.
Khattar said students passing Class X and XII from Haryana School Education Board would get certificates through digital locker.
He also launched “Knowledge Warehouse” set up in Gurgaon to promote start-ups through video-conference.
Addressing deputy commissioners through video-conference, the chief minister directed them to ensure installation of rate lists of various services being provided at CSCs.
He also extended greetings to former prime minister Atal Bihari Vajpayee on his birthday. While interacting with media persons, the chief minister described Vajpayee as a highly regarded and widely respected leader
